软件公司软件开发岗位职业发展路径探索_第1页
软件公司软件开发岗位职业发展路径探索_第2页
软件公司软件开发岗位职业发展路径探索_第3页
软件公司软件开发岗位职业发展路径探索_第4页
软件公司软件开发岗位职业发展路径探索_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件公司软件开发岗位职业发展路径探索第页软件公司软件开发岗位职业发展路径探索在数字化时代,软件行业作为推动科技进步的核心力量,其职业发展路径对于个人和企业的成长都具有重要意义。软件开发岗位作为软件公司的核心角色,其职业发展路径具有多元化和层次化的特点。本文将详细探讨软件公司软件开发岗位的职业发展路径,帮助从业者明确职业方向,实现个人价值。一、入门阶段软件开发岗位的入门阶段,主要聚焦于基础技能的培养和扎实技术的形成。新入职的开发者通常从基础编程技能开始学习,如编程语言、数据结构和算法等。在这一阶段,开发者通过参与项目,积累经验,逐渐掌握软件开发的基本流程和规范。二、成长阶段在入门之后,开发者将进入成长阶段。这个阶段需要不断提升技术水平,拓宽知识领域。除了基础编程技能外,还需要掌握软件工程、数据库管理、系统架构等相关知识。此外,开发者还需要关注行业动态,了解新技术、新趋势,保持技术创新的热情。在成长阶段,开发者可以通过参与更多项目实践,提升解决实际问题的能力。同时,参加技术培训、分享会等活动,与同行交流,有助于拓宽视野,提升个人价值。三、专业深化阶段随着经验的积累和技术水平的提升,开发者将进入专业深化阶段。在这个阶段,开发者需要选择专业领域,成为技术领域的专家。例如,前端开、后端开发、数据库管理、测试等岗位都有其深入的技术领域。在专业深化阶段,开发者需要关注行业前沿技术,不断提升自身竞争力。通过参与大型项目、主导技术团队等方式,积累实践经验,成为技术领域的佼佼者。同时,参与行业内的技术研讨、标准制定等活动,有助于提升个人在行业内的知名度和影响力。四、管理阶段在技术达到一定水平后,开发者可能会转向管理岗位。从技术管理、项目管理到部门管理,逐步承担更多的责任。在这一阶段,除了技术能力外,还需要提升领导力、团队协作、项目管理等能力。在管理阶段,开发者需要学会跨部门沟通、协调资源、制定战略等技能。通过参与企业战略制定、项目管理等任务,提升全局观念和决策能力。同时,关注团队成长,培养团队成员的技术能力和职业素养,打造高效团队。五、高层领导阶段最后,部分优秀的开发者会晋升为公司高层领导,承担公司战略制定、业务发展等重任。在这一阶段,除了技术和管理能力外,还需要具备战略眼光、市场洞察力、创新思维等能力。作为高层领导,需要关注市场动态,把握行业趋势,制定公司发展战略。同时,关注公司文化建设,营造良好的企业氛围,激发员工潜力。通过整合内外部资源,推动公司业务发展,实现企业的长期价值。软件公司软件开发岗位的职业发展路径是一个不断学习和成长的过程。从入门到成长,再到专业深化、管理以及高层领导阶段,每个阶段都需要不断提升技能和能力,以适应行业发展和市场需求。开发者应保持学习热情,关注行业动态,努力实现个人价值的同时,为公司的发展做出贡献。软件公司软件开发岗位职业发展路径探索随着信息技术的飞速发展,软件行业已经成为当今社会的核心产业之一。对于在软件公司从事软件开发工作的人员来说,如何在这个竞争激烈的领域中实现自我价值的提升,走向职业发展的高峰,成为了一个值得深思和探索的问题。本文将围绕软件公司软件开发岗位的职业发展路径展开探索,旨在为相关从业者提供有益的参考和指导。一、初级阶段:技术扎实,积累经验软件开发岗位的初级阶段,主要侧重于技术能力的提升和工作经验的积累。在这一阶段,开发者需要:1.熟练掌握编程语言:熟练掌握至少一门主流编程语言,如Java、Python、C++等,并了解相关技术的生态体系。2.掌握基本开发技能:熟悉软件开发流程,包括需求分析、系统设计、编码、测试等基本技能。3.积累实践经验:通过参与实际项目,锻炼自己的开发能力,积累经验。二、中级阶段:技术与管理并重进入中级阶段的开发者,除了技术能力之外,还需要加强管理和协作能力的培养。在这一阶段,开发者需要:1.深化技术专长:在某一技术领域达到专家水平,形成自己的技术专长。2.提升项目管理能力:学习项目管理知识,提高项目管理能力,能够独立完成项目的需求分析、设计、开发、测试等工作。3.加强团队协作:学会与团队成员有效沟通、协作,提高团队效率。三、高级阶段:战略思维,领导力展现高级阶段的开发者已经具备了较强的技术和管理能力,需要进一步提升战略思维和领导力。在这一阶段,开发者需要:1.战略思考:从公司的战略高度思考软件开发工作,为公司的发展提供技术支持。2.团队管理:有效管理团队,激发团队成员的潜力,提高团队整体绩效。3.把握行业动态:关注行业动态,不断学习和掌握新技术,引领团队跟上行业发展步伐。四、走向更高层次:跨界融合,创新引领在软件行业的最高层次,跨界融合和创新引领成为了关键。在这一阶段,开发者需要:1.跨界合作:与其他行业领域进行合作,将技术与其他行业相结合,创造新的价值。2.创新思维:具备强烈的创新意识,勇于尝试新的技术、方法和思路。3.领导整个软件公司或组织:担任高级管理职位,领导整个软件公司或组织走向更高的成就。五、持续提升与自我更新无论处于哪个阶段的开发者,都需要不断学习和提升自我。在软件行业,技术更新换代迅速,开发者需要保持敏锐的洞察力,紧跟行业发展趋势。此外,还需要培养良好的职业素养和心态,如敬业精神、团队协作精神、抗压能力等。软件公司软件开发岗位的职业发展路径是一个不断积累、不断提升的过程。开发者需要在技术能力提升的同时,注重管理和协作能力的培养,不断拓宽视野,关注行业动态,保持创新思维。只有这样,才能在软件行业的激烈竞争中脱颖而出,走向职业发展的高峰。软件公司软件开发岗位职业发展路径探索的文章,你可以按照以下结构进行编制:一、引言简要介绍软件公司软件开发岗位的重要性,以及职业发展路径对于员工和公司发展的意义。阐述本文将深入探讨软件开发岗位的职业发展路径,包括关键阶段、成长机会和晋升渠道等。二、软件开发岗位概述简述软件开发岗位的主要职责和工作内容,如参与项目需求分析、系统设计、编码实现、测试优化等。强调该岗位的技术性和创新性,以及在公司业务中的地位和作用。三、职业发展路径1.初级阶段:描述新入职软件开发人员的工作内容,如参与项目基础开发任务、学习新技术和工具等。强调在这一阶段需要掌握的基础技能和团队协作能力。2.成长阶段:阐述在积累一定经验后,软件开发人员需要提升的技能和能力,如独立承担项目模块、参与系统架构设计等。同时,介绍公司提供的培训和学习机会,如内部培训、外部研讨会等。3.晋升阶段:详细介绍软件开发岗位的高级职责,如项目负责人、技术团队领导等。分析在这一阶段需要具备的领导能力、项目管理能力等,并阐述公司如何支持员工在这一阶段的成长和发展。四、职业发展路径的支撑措施介绍公司为促进软件开发岗位职业发展路径所采取的措施,包括内部晋升制度、激励机制、培训制度、团队建设等。强调公司如何为员工创造有利于职业发展的环境和条件。五、成功案例分享分享公司内部软件开发岗位职业发展的成功案例,介绍这些员工在职业发展过程中的经验和教训,以及他们是如何通过努力和公司的支持实现职业晋升的。六、结论总结软件开发岗位的职业发展

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论